This website requires Javascript for some parts to function propertly. Your experience may vary.

Associate Full-Stack Software Engineer

Associate Full-Stack Software Engineer

February 26, 2026

Associate Full-Stack Software Engineer 

Job Brief

We are looking for an experienced Associate Full-Stack Software Engineer to lead/contribute to the development of internal software within our Software Engineering department. This position will report directly to the Software Engineering Manager and play a key role in helping the company maintain and develop new and existing applications.

Detail

Work Location: Headquarters, Shawnee, KS

Department: Software Engineering

Job Type: Full-time, In-person

Reports to: Software Engineering Manager

The essence of this role:

  • Develop high-quality, testable, and well-documented code in a full stack environment that includes Vue, React, Alpine.js, PHP, Laravel, MySQL (or any other relational database) and others

  • Build and/or contribute to broad application architectures that are both scalable and performant

  • Solve problems with both code and data to provide informed solutions to Schier’s internal teams and an array of customer types

  • Implementing and supporting CI/CD pipelines to automate common processes, and test and deploy code

  • Work in an in-person environment with direct access to stakeholders

The typical daily and weekly activities of this role:

  • Participate in daily stand-up meetings with the software development team

  • Managing your own individual workload by monitoring your assigned tasks, allowing you to resolve 50-80% of bug reports within the same business day

  • Contributing to Schier’s digital ecosystem by deploying stable and performant features and/or bug fixes at least three to five times a week

  • Be willing to both function as part of a team and the ability to take ownership of an idea/initiative and push it forward using ideation and innovation

  • Have the continuous aspiration to keep skills and knowledge of industry trends/movements fresh

  • Collaborate with both internal and external development team members and clearly communicate solutions to both technical and non-technical team members

  • Being able to accept an assigned task and complete it to the best of your ability that is both stable and clean. Must be willing to ask for help and/or advice to complete tasks in a timely manner

  • Showing a strong analytic and investigative desire for solving problems and providing innovative solutions using software and cloud-based technology

Required Qualifications for this role:

  • At least 6 years of product/software development experience

  • Have deep familiarity with the PHP language and Laravel framework

  • Deep understanding of object-oriented programming

  • Fluent and comfortable with at least one modern JavaScript framework (i.e. Angular, React, Vue.js, etc)

  • Experience with implementing and extending TailwindCSS

  • An applicable understanding of modern relational databases such as MySQL or PostgreSQL, and their use within applications

  • An applicable understanding and willingness to implement test-driven development in your daily work

  • A practical understanding of different authentication methods such as OAuth, Bearer tokens, and JWTs, along with their respective advantages and disadvantages

  • Experience building and maintaining a REST API, including but not limited to GraphQL

  • A working knowledge of modern CI/CD principles and practices

  • Ability to multi-task across multiple projects, applications, and features simultaneously and prioritize work accordingly

  • Ability to participate in peer code reviews and provide constructive feedback

  • Ability to identify and consume code or project-related documentation and apply it effectively

Preferred Qualifications for this role:

  • Familiarity and comfort with the macOS operating system

  • A strong grasp of employing AI in development processes without overreliance

  • Experience with cloud-native technologies like Docker and Kubernetes

  • Experience with Google Cloud Platform or DigitalOcean

  • Ability to maintain and contribute to open source projects

  • Ability to implement various container-based CI/CD processes using GitHub Actions, Harness, CircleCI, etc.

  • Ability and willingness to mentor junior developers on various aspects of application development

What We Do

Schier is the leading manufacturer of grease interceptors for commercial kitchens in the United States. While you may have never heard our name, odds are great that you've walked over the top of one of our products -- probably today. Over the last 20 years, we have earned the reputation as the product and knowledge leader in our field. 

US sewers are aging poorly, and kitchen waste (food scraps and grease) is the leading cause of sewer problems: clogs, overflows, and capacity reduction. The resulting maintenance and repair costs taxpayers hundreds of millions of dollars each year. Schier takes a unique and comprehensive approach to minimize this problem, and our dual commitment to environmental stewardship and fiscal prudence goes hand-in-hand. By blocking food waste from the sewer and preventing damage, we not only extend the life of sewers and save taxpayers tens of millions of dollars annually but also contribute to a healthier and cleaner environment. 

Why We Do It

Our focus is the kitchen waste market, but our purpose is service to people - specifically our employees. Employees that are respected and taken care of are better equipped, emotionally and financially, to be of service to their own families, communities, and Schier’s customers. By serving one another, we hope to have an exponentially good impact on the world. 

Working At Schier

We are thorough in the consideration and design of our jobs so that they are challenging, stable, and directly connected to company success. Our compensation approach is informed by our employee-service focus, and balances time-off, pace, pay, and benefits, including the unique wealth-building opportunity of our 100% ESOP structure. Our managers provide a transparent and information-rich environment that encourages employees to be more and more self-directed. The result is a culture that is found on the best teams - undramatic,  good-natured and highly successful. 

You will fit our culture if your friends describe you as:

  • Humble (we value this trait first and foremost)

  • Self-motivated (our employees own stock in the company, we’re all entrepreneurs who pull our own weight)

  • Low-maintenance (emotionally intelligent, great on a team)

As a member of our team you will have a manager who:

  • Gives clear directions

  • Makes sure you have the necessary tools

  • Acts with the greater good in mind

  • Delegates appropriately

  • Takes time to truly understand your role and how you can help the company

  • Makes their expectations clear

  • Communicates well

  • Has effective meetings

  • Meets one-on-one with you regarding your performance at least 3 times per year

  • Rewards and recognizes your performance

Comprehensive Benefits Package:

  • Medical, dental, vision, and life insurance coverage for your entire family (including pets)

  • 100% Employee Owned (Employee Stock Ownership Plan, also known as ESOP)

  • Quarterly profit sharing bonus

  • 3% 401(k) safe harbor

  • Paid holidays and PTO policy that promotes a healthy work/life balance


If you are interested in this position, please email your resume and cover letter  to: careers@schierproducts.com


Please note, Schier does not offer sponsorship of job applicants for employment-based visas or any other work authorization at this time. Any offer of employment with Schier is contingent on a successful criminal background check and drug screen. Applicants for our positions are considered without regard to race, ethnicity, national origin, sex, sexual orientation, gender identity or expression, age, disability, religion, military or veteran status, or any other characteristics protected by law.

Scroll To Top